Tomcat集群文件同步的方法有多種,以下是其中幾種常見的方法:
使用網絡共享文件系統:可以將Tomcat所需的文件(如WAR包、配置文件等)存儲在一個網絡共享文件系統中,集群中的所有節點都可以訪問該文件系統并同步文件。常用的網絡共享文件系統包括NFS(Network File System)和CIFS(Common Internet File System)等。
使用分布式文件系統:可以使用分布式文件系統來存儲和同步Tomcat的文件。常用的分布式文件系統包括Hadoop HDFS、GlusterFS等。
使用版本控制系統:可以使用版本控制系統(如Git、SVN等)來管理Tomcat的文件,并利用版本控制系統的分支、合并等功能來同步文件。可以在集群的每個節點上都克隆版本控制系統的倉庫,并定時或手動拉取最新的文件。這種方法需要對版本控制系統的操作和使用有一定的了解。
使用文件同步工具:可以使用文件同步工具(如rsync、Unison等)來同步Tomcat的文件。可以將一個節點上的文件作為源文件,將其他節點上的文件作為目標文件,然后使用文件同步工具進行文件同步。
無論使用哪種方法,都需要注意文件同步的頻率和一致性。頻率過高可能會對性能產生負面影響,而一致性不足可能會導致節點之間的文件差異,影響集群的正常工作。因此,需要根據具體的需求和環境選擇合適的文件同步方法,并進行適當的調整和優化。